So, practice was short. Lasted about an hour and twenty minutes.

Davis knocked down a few mid range jumpers and had some nice pick and roll and in bound play dunks. I told y'all already about the dive for a loose ball play. Chill Davis, it's "practice". Gotta love the hustle though.

Rivers got in the lane and made some nice passes. Love his floater. Great shot for a guard to have mastered. He will take that shot from deep. Looks kinda weird from too far out, but it can be effective.

Roger mason knocked down three 3s in the scrimmage.

Lopez gets in the right spots on offense. He was very effective picking and rolling and finishing with hooks around the rim. He impressed me. And he is just big. Nice to have a true center with some size on the hornets.

Smiht didn't practice. Gordon didn't practice, but he was there and joking with teammates on the bench.

Greivis was great. The practice started with some offense only drills and then went to scrimmage. He finished the drills with a dunk and a pump the crowd up gesture to the fans. He made several great passes to Davis and Lopez for buckets during the scrimmage. He was a great leader. High fived all his teammates after the scrimmage win. Afterwards, he gestured for all his teammates to follow him to the stands. He seemed genuinely excited to interact with the fans. I'm a fan of him. Rootin for him this season.

Monty gave a speech at the end saying how much he and the team loved the city and the fans. Thanked us for comin out

Smith introduced the lineups when the scrimmage started. It was short, but we had a good time
